This property is not currently for sale or for rent on Trulia. The description and property data below may have been provided by a third party, the homeowner or public records.
This condo is located at 5696 Landfall Dr, Virginia Beach, VA. 5696 Landfall Dr is in the Kempsville neighborhood in Virginia Beach, VA and in ZIP code 23462. This property has 2 bedrooms, 1 bathroom and approximately 816 sqft of floor space. This property was built in 1988.
